Fernandina, FL- Bank of Fernandina $10 Faded G4a Benice 5 PMG Very Fine 20 Net.
The bank was organized in 1859 and remained in operation until 1862 when the capture of Fernandina by Union forces resulted in it moving to Starke. The note depicts a wagon load of cotton bales and a young woman. A bright red denominational end panel with a large white X is on both ends. PMG net graded the note due to some really minimal edge damage.
